A parent sees a 103-degree reading and a persistent cough at 9:00 PM on a Tuesday. They may ask a mobile assistant which nearby urgent care location is open, whether it evaluates children, whether a stated insurance plan is currently accepted, and whether rapid testing is available.
That prompt is not merely a local search. It combines timing, age range, service capability, payment, and clinical-suitability questions, any of which an AI response can state incorrectly.
The answer may compare locations using published hours, service pages, directory records, insurer data, and the documented credentials and capabilities of the clinical team. An urgent care organization cannot control the final response, but it can control much of the first-party evidence that systems may retrieve.
Each location should have a dependable record of its address, phone number, current hours, access instructions, age limitations, testing and imaging capabilities, occupational health services, payment process, and clear redirection language for needs outside its scope.
